Abstract

Synchronous learning is a component of online learning for engaging students in real-time. It is the nearest we can get to a live feeling in the e-environment. These sessions must be designed in a way to keep students continuously involved. This paper aims to provide health professional educators with tips for increasing student engagement in the online synchronous environment. The relevant literature regarding student engagement and synchronous online learning was reviewed and collated with the authors’ own experiences, to formulate these tips. Health professional educators can use these tips to enhance student engagement in online synchronous classes. Increased student engagement in online sessions, means better learning. These tips have been tried and tested by the authors as being satisfactory for increasing student interest in synchronous sessions and hence providing an optimal learning experience online.
